It was looking last night to decal a RN Buccaneer as i have various sheets and noticed the Anti-flash blue used for the serials and stencilling varies from manufacturer to manufacturer in both shade and depth of colour - Even Model Alliance sheets varied between sets. I have Freightdogs Anti-flash sheet, but whilst it covers the serials i need, it doesn't have the stencilling and doesn't match the colour used on those kits with the stencils  :banghead:.

Could really do with a definative RN Buccaneer sheet that covers 800, 801, 803, and 809, with a variety of the squadron aircraft numbers and serial numbers. This is especially so with 800 squadron as they had white numbers out lined in black and had the last two digits repeated in white on a red diamond marking so it would be nice to be able to have those as seperate makings to give a bigger variety of squadron aircraft rather than just a single option.
